Chilli plants love heat.Chillies also don't mind humidity as much as sweet peppers or tomatoes do.Most people will need to grow chillis in full sun.In the hottest, sunniest regions chillies still grow well with a bit of shade. Pinch out the growing tip when the chilli plant gets to about 20cm high - this encourages bushy growth and better crops.
